Any breaks in elevation of _______ or more require a step or riser. Stairs consisting of _______or more risers or those ________ or more in height require a handrail.

Final answer:

Stairs need a step or riser for elevation breaks of 7.5 inches or more, and a handrail if there are four or more risers or they are 30 inches high.

Step-by-step explanation:

Any breaks in elevation of 7.5 inches (19 cm) or more require a step or riser. Stairs consisting of four or more risers or those 30 inches (76 cm) or more in height require a handrail.

These measurements are based on safety codes and standards to prevent accidents and ensure the safe use of stairs. In constructing or evaluating stair safety, measurements such as the step width and step height are vital considerations.
